IPL 2025: ‘Mature’ Karun Nair eager to grab opportunities in second DC stint


Karun Nair has said that he is eager to grab the opportunities that will come his way during his second stint with Delhi Capitals during the IPL 2025 campaign. Karun spent 2 seasons with the then-Delhi Daredevils in 2016 and 2017 and even captained the franchise in 3 matches.

In 2016, Karun scored 357 runs in 14 matches and followed it up with 281 in the 2017 campaign. The 33-year-old comes to the IPL on the back of some top performances on the domestic circuit for Vidarbha and is ready for the start of the new season.

Speaking to India Today in an exclusive interaction, Karun said he has had great memories with the Delhi franchise and is looking forward to making new ones with DC. The 33-year-old said he is coming back as a more mature player and will aim to bring that into the IPL this season.

“I always had tremendous and great memories. Looking forward to making new memories this time. I’m coming back a much more mature player than I was back then and understanding my game a lot more. So, I will try to bring that into the IPL now and taking one game at a time and hopefully, I get some opportunities and can grab those opportunities,” said Karun.

What will be Karun’s role this season?

When asked about his role with the team, Karun said it would be premature to talk about it as he feels DC have a great squad with everyone in good touch.

“I think for myself, it is too premature to say what role I’ll be playing and, you know, but we’ve built a great squad this time and now everyone looks in great touch and looking forward to getting to know everyone a lot better and playing alongside them. I’m really excited to share the dressing room with a lot of these guys,” said Karun.

DC will start their campaign in Vizag against Lucknow Super Giants and Rishabh Pant on March 24.
